21st Century Respect Act

H.R. 381 · 116th Congress · Jan 9, 2019 · Lineage

A BILL

To direct the Secretary of Agriculture and the Administrator of General Services to modernize terms in certain regulations.

1. Short title

This Act may be cited as the “21st Century Respect Act”.

2. Amendments to regulations required

(a)
Secretary of Agriculture— The Secretary of Agriculture shall amend section 1901.202(g) of title 7, Code of Federal Regulations, to—
(1)
strike “Negro or Black” and insert “Black or African American”;
(2)
strike “Spanish Surname” and insert “Hispanic”; and
(3)
strike “Oriental” and insert “Asian American or Pacific Islander”.
(b)
Administrator of General Services— The Administrator of General Services shall amend section 906.2(k) of title 36, Code of Federal Regulations, to—
(1)
strike “Negro”, each place it appears, and insert “Black or African American”;
(2)
strike paragraph (1) (the definition of “Negro”) and insert the following: “(1) Black or African American—is an individual having origins in any of the Black racial groups of Africa”;
(3)
strike “Oriental”, each place it appears, and insert “Asian American or Pacific Islander”;
(4)
strike “Eskimo”, each place it appears, and insert “Alaska Native”; and
(5)
strike “Aleut”, each place it appears, and insert “Alaska Native”.

3. Rule of construction

Nothing in this Act, or the amendments required by this Act, shall be construed to affect Federal law, except with respect to the use of terms by the Secretary of Agriculture and the Administrator of General Services, respectively, to the regulations affected by this Act.
